FELIX GIRARD, Petitioner, v. THE EIGHTH JUDICIAL DISTRICT COURT OF THE STATE OF NEVADA, IN AND FOR THE COUNTY OF CLARK; AND THE HONORABLE MARY KAY HOLTHUS, DISTRICT JUDGE, Respondents, LIFE LINE SCREENING OF AMERICA, LLC; AND LIFE LINE SCREENING HOLDINGS, LLC, Real Parties in Interest.
ORDER DENYING PETITION
This original petition for a writ of mandamus or prohibition challenges a district court order granting summary judgment in a tort action.
Petitioner Felix Girard claims that writ relief is necessary to clarify whether an exculpatory waiver that prospectively limits liability of health care providers for negligence is void as against public policy in Nevada. Having reviewed the petition, we decline to exercise our discretion to entertain the petition. D.R. Horton, Inc. v. Eighth Judicial Dist. Court, 123 Nev. 468, 475, 168 P.3d 731, 737 (2007) (recognizing this court's broad discretion in determining whether to consider a writ petition). Writ relief is generally not available where a plain, speedy and adequate legal remedy exists, such as an appeal from a final judgment. Pan v. Eighth Judicial Dist. Court, 120 Nev. 222, 224, 88 P.3d 840, 841 (2004). Because petitioner has an adequate remedy at law by way of an appeal, we deny the petition.
IT is so ORDERED.
Herndon, J.
Lee, J.
Parraguirre, J.
